    Why does my cat have hot spots?
    Hot spots on cats are more than itchy patches of skin. They’re oozing, raw indicators that your cat is suffering from deeper physical or psychological problems. While it’s easy to heal your cat’s raw skin at home, your real, and often long-term, challenge is identifying and eliminating the root cause of your cat’s hot spots. Why Buy from Chewy?

    Cat Hot Spot Treatment at Home using colloidal silver Why do cats get hot spots?
    Hot spots typically develop as the result of minor irritation caused by fleas, allergies, or another source of itchiness or pain. If your cat scratches, chews, gnaws, or licks himself too much, the natural bacteria will infect the irritated skin, creating a vicious cycle of itching and re-irritation. Pain is also a factor.

    Can You microwave formula for kittens?
    Never microwave the formula. It depletes some nutrients and can cause hot spots that burn a kitten's mouth. Instead, when feeding kittens, soak a bottle in a bowl of hot water. After a minute, test the temperature of the formula on the inside of your wrist. It should feel warm, but not hot.
